Et si vous pouviez déléguer les parties les plus fastidieuses de votre flux de travail de codage à des assistants spécialisés qui ne perdent jamais de concentration, commettent moins d'erreurs et s'adaptent parfaitement à vos besoins? Entrer Sous-agents de code Claudeune nouvelle innovation qui remodèle comment les développeurs abordent des projets complexes. Imaginez déboguer, tester ou générer des documents sans les frais généraux mentaux de jongler avec plusieurs tâches. Ces sous-agents agissent en tant que collaborateurs construits à l'usage, conçus pour gérer des responsabilités spécifiques avec précision et efficacité. En automatisant les tâches répétitives et en maintenant le contexte spécifique à la tâche, les sous-agents vous libèrent de vous concentrer sur ce qui compte vraiment: résoudre des problèmes stratégiques et créer d'excellents logiciels.
Dans cette exploration de la Claude Code Sub-Agents WorkflowLe monde de l'IA découvre comment ces outils modulaires peuvent transformer votre processus de développement. De la réduction des erreurs à l'amélioration du multitâche, les sous-agents sont plus qu'une simple augmentation de la productivité – ils sont une façon plus intelligente de gérer la complexité. Vous apprendrez comment ils fonctionnent, comment les mettre en place et les scénarios du monde réel où ils brillent, comme le débogage ou la rationalisation de projets à grande échelle. Que vous soyez un développeur solo ou une partie d'une équipe collaborative, ces informations révéleront comment les sous-agents peuvent vous aider à travailler plus intelligemment, pas plus difficile. Au fur et à mesure que vous lisez, considérez comment votre flux de travail actuel pourrait évoluer avec des outils conçus pour s'adapter à vos défis uniques.
Que sont les sous-agents?
TL; Dr Key à retenir:
- Les sous-agents du code Claude sont des outils modulaires spécifiques à la tâche conçus pour rationaliser les workflows de codage en automatisant des tâches répétitives comme le débogage, les tests et la documentation.
- Chaque sous-agent fonctionne avec sa propre invite de système et son ensemble d'outils, en veillant à la précision, en réduisant les erreurs et en maintenant un contexte spécifique à la tâche pour une meilleure efficacité.
- Les sous-agents sont hautement personnalisables et évolutifs, permettant aux développeurs d'adapter leur comportement, leurs outils et leurs autorisations pour répondre aux exigences de projet uniques.
- Les cas d'utilisation clés comprennent l'automatisation du débogage, la génération de documents détaillés, l'exécution de tests complets et la déléguation de tâches dans des projets complexes pour une organisation améliorée.
- En intégrant des sous-agents, les développeurs peuvent se concentrer sur la résolution stratégique de problèmes, réduire la charge cognitive et améliorer la productivité dans les projets à petite et à grande échelle.
Les sous-agents sont des outils modulaires construits à un objectif conçus pour lutter contre des tâches spécifiques telles que le débogage, les tests ou la génération de documentation. Chaque sous-agent fonctionne avec sa propre invite système, son ensemble d'outils et sa fenêtre de contexte, en s'assurant de la précision et de la minimisation des risques tels que l'hallucination ou l'interprétation erronée. Cette approche ciblée vous permet de déléguer efficacement les tâches, en vous assurant que chaque sous-agent se concentre uniquement sur son domaine d'expertise. En isolant les responsabilités, les sous-agents améliorent la précision et réduisent la probabilité d'erreurs, ce qui en fait une partie indispensable des flux de travail de développement modernes.
Comment fonctionnent les sous-agents
Claude Code fonctionne comme un chef de projet virtuel, attribuant intelligemment les tâches aux sous-agents les plus appropriés. Ces agents sont réutilisables dans différents projets et équipes, offrant à la fois la flexibilité et l'évolutivité. Avec des autorisations et un comportement configurables, vous pouvez adapter chaque sous-agent pour répondre aux exigences uniques de votre flux de travail. Par exemple, vous pouvez configurer un sous-agent pour gérer le débogage tandis qu'un autre se concentre sur la documentation. Cette adaptabilité garantit un alignement transparent avec les objectifs de votre projet, que vous travailliez sur une petite fonctionnalité ou une application à grande échelle.
Claude Code Sub-Agents Workflow
Obtenez une nouvelle expertise dans Claude Code en consultant ces recommandations.
Configuration des sous-agents
Pour commencer à utiliser des sous-agents, vous devez installer Claude Code et vous assurer que Node.js 18+ est installé. Le processus de configuration consiste à définir les types d'agents, les outils et les invites pour personnaliser leur comportement. Cette configuration garantit que chaque sous-agent est équipé pour gérer efficacement les tâches spécifiques. Les étapes clés du processus de configuration comprennent:
- Identifier les tâches que vous souhaitez automatiser, comme le débogage ou les tests.
- Configuration des invites système pour guider le comportement de chaque sous-agent.
- Attribuer les outils et autorisations appropriés à chaque agent.
En adaptant des sous-agents aux exigences de votre projet, vous pouvez les intégrer de manière transparente dans votre flux de travail. Cela améliore non seulement la productivité, mais réduit également l'effort manuel requis pour les tâches répétitives.
Cas d'utilisation clés pour les sous-agents
Les sous-agents sont des outils polyvalents qui peuvent être appliqués à un large éventail de scénarios de développement. Certains des cas d'utilisation les plus percutants comprennent:
- Débogage: Automatisation de l'identification et de la résolution des erreurs de code pour gagner du temps et améliorer la précision.
- Documentation: Générer une documentation détaillée et spécifique au projet pour améliorer la collaboration et le partage des connaissances de l'équipe.
- Essai: Exécuter des cas de test complets pour assurer la fiabilité et les performances du code.
- Délégation des tâches: Décomposer des projets complexes en composants gérables, permettant une meilleure organisation et une réalisation plus rapide.
Ces cas d'utilisation démontrent la valeur pratique des sous-agents pour simplifier les flux de travail et améliorer l'efficacité globale.
Avantages des sous-agents
L'intégration de sous-agents dans votre flux de travail de codage offre plusieurs avantages distincts. Ceux-ci incluent:
- Efficacité accrue: En automatisant les tâches répétitives, les sous-agents libèrent votre temps pour la résolution de problèmes et l'innovation de niveau supérieur.
- Gestion de contexte améliorée: Chaque sous-agent maintient un contexte spécifique à la tâche, réduisant les erreurs et la confusion pendant le développement.
- Personnalisation: Vous pouvez adapter des sous-agents avec des outils et des invites spécifiques pour répondre aux besoins uniques de votre projet.
- Évolutivité: Les sous-agents peuvent être réutilisés sur plusieurs projets, ce qui en fait une solution rentable pour les équipes de toutes tailles.
Ces avantages réduisent collectivement la charge cognitive, vous permettant de vous concentrer sur les décisions stratégiques tandis que les sous-agents gèrent les détails opérationnels.
Personnalisation et flexibilité
L'une des caractéristiques les plus convaincantes des sous-agents est leur adaptabilité. Vous pouvez les personnaliser au niveau du projet et des utilisateurs, en vous assurant qu'ils s'alignent avec vos besoins spécifiques. Des exemples de personnalisation comprennent:
- Configuration d'un agent pour automatiser les scénarios de test, en vous assurant une couverture et une fiabilité approfondies.
- Configuration d'un agent pour rationaliser la conception des interfaces utilisateur, l'amélioration de l'utilisabilité et de l'expérience utilisateur.
- L'ajustement des autorisations et des flux de travail pour s'aligner sur les exigences spécifiques à l'équipe, en s'assurant une collaboration transparente.
Cette flexibilité permet aux sous-agents d'évoluer aux côtés de vos projets, en s'adaptant à de nouveaux défis et priorités à mesure qu'ils surviennent. Que vous travailliez sur une petite fonctionnalité ou que vous gériez une application à grande échelle, les sous-agents fournissent les outils dont vous avez besoin pour rester agile et efficace.
Applications du monde réel
Les applications pratiques des sous-agents sont étendues, ce qui en fait un atout précieux dans divers scénarios de développement. Par exemple, vous pouvez utiliser des sous-agents pour:
- Automatiser les tâches répétitives dans l'inscription des workflows, ce qui permet d'économiser du temps et des efforts.
- Concevoir des interfaces utilisateur intuitives qui améliorent l'expérience utilisateur globale.
- Déléguer les tâches dans des projets à grande échelle, en s'assurant de l'achèvement en temps opportun et une meilleure organisation.
- Rationaliser les processus de débogage, identifier et résoudre rapidement les problèmes pour maintenir les délais du projet.
En intégrant des sous-agents dans vos projets, vous pouvez obtenir une plus grande précision et efficacité. Cela améliore non seulement la qualité de votre travail, mais accélère également les délais de développement, vous permettant de fournir de meilleurs résultats plus rapidement.
L'avenir du codage des workflows
Les sous-agents de code Claude représentent une étape fantastique dans la façon dont les développeurs abordent les workflows de codage. En permettant aux agents spécifiques aux tâches, vous pouvez déléguer les responsabilités, préserver le contexte et optimiser facilement les processus. Leur adaptabilité, leur précision et leur efficacité en font un ajout puissant à la boîte à outils de tout développeur. Que vous vous attaquiez à une petite fonctionnalité ou que vous gérez un projet complexe multi-équipes, les sous-agents fournissent les outils dont vous avez besoin pour simplifier les flux de travail et obtenir de meilleurs résultats. Alors que les défis de développement continuent d'évoluer, les sous-agents offrent une solution évolutive et intelligente pour répondre aux exigences de l'ingénierie logicielle moderne.
Crédit médiatique: WorldOfai
Filed Under: AI, Top News
Dernières offres de gadgets geek
Divulgation: Certains de nos articles incluent des liens d'affiliation. Si vous achetez quelque chose via l'un de ces liens, les gadgets geek peuvent gagner une commission d'affiliation. Découvrez notre politique de divulgation.
Vous pouvez lire l’article original (en Angais) sur le {site|blog}www.geeky-gadgets.com